    If I was able to currently make any fight in boxing it would be this.

    Chocolatito is P4P the best in the world (the vast majority of serious fans/boxing writers agree). Monster is probably not that far behind him but obviously has far less fights.
    100% it was on my wish list. These are the 2 best p4p in my mind. Inoue only 9 fights in and already a 2 weight world champ. Its Floyds 9th pro fight he fought a guy who had one win in 15 fights
    Since you are taking the unnecessary dig I will offer an unnecessary retort.

    You are correct. But Inoue is also nearing 23 and by that age Floyd had fought many title fights including Diego Corrales who was 33-0 and Genaro Hernandez, Angel Manfredy, Carlos Alberto Ramon Rios, Justin Juuko, Carlos Gerena and Gregorio Vargas.

    Two ways to look at things where 1 looks better 1 way the other looks better the other way. The question is should people look through a narrow scope to see the view they want or be honest about the picture by looking at it all.

    Great start to a career by Inoue
